HomeSort by relevance Sort by last modified time
    Searched refs:CurrCycle (Results 1 - 8 of 8) sorted by null

  /external/swiftshader/third_party/llvm-7.0/llvm/lib/Target/Hexagon/
HexagonMachineScheduler.h 145 unsigned CurrCycle = 0;
169 CurrCycle = 0;
211 if (CurrCycle >= CriticalPathLength)
214 return CriticalPathLength - CurrCycle <= PathLength;
HexagonMachineScheduler.cpp 354 if (ReadyCycle > CurrCycle || checkHazard(SU))
368 unsigned NextCycle = std::max(CurrCycle + 1, MinReadyCycle);
372 CurrCycle = NextCycle;
375 for (; CurrCycle != NextCycle; ++CurrCycle) {
385 << CurrCycle << '\n');
409 LLVM_DEBUG(dbgs() << "*** Max instrs at cycle " << CurrCycle << '\n');
414 << CurrCycle << '\n');
433 if (ReadyCycle > CurrCycle)
    [all...]
  /external/llvm/lib/Target/Hexagon/
HexagonMachineScheduler.cpp 295 if (ReadyCycle > CurrCycle || checkHazard(SU))
308 unsigned NextCycle = std::max(CurrCycle + 1, MinReadyCycle);
312 CurrCycle = NextCycle;
315 for (; CurrCycle != NextCycle; ++CurrCycle) {
325 << CurrCycle << '\n');
349 DEBUG(dbgs() << "*** Max instrs at cycle " << CurrCycle << '\n');
354 << " at cycle " << CurrCycle << '\n');
373 if (ReadyCycle > CurrCycle)
682 << (IsTopNode ? Top.CurrCycle : Bot.CurrCycle) << '\n'
    [all...]
HexagonMachineScheduler.h 143 unsigned CurrCycle;
158 CurrCycle(0), IssueCount(0),
  /external/llvm/include/llvm/CodeGen/
MachineScheduler.h 601 unsigned CurrCycle;
618 /// time=CurrCycle assuming the first scheduled instr is retired at time=0.
669 unsigned getCurrCycle() const { return CurrCycle; }
685 return std::max(ExpectedLatency, CurrCycle);
708 return std::max(CurrCycle * SchedModel->getLatencyFactor(),
    [all...]
  /external/swiftshader/third_party/llvm-7.0/llvm/include/llvm/CodeGen/
MachineScheduler.h 638 unsigned CurrCycle;
655 /// time=CurrCycle assuming the first scheduled instr is retired at time=0.
704 unsigned getCurrCycle() const { return CurrCycle; }
716 return std::max(ExpectedLatency, CurrCycle);
739 return std::max(CurrCycle * SchedModel->getLatencyFactor(),
    [all...]
  /external/llvm/lib/CodeGen/
MachineScheduler.cpp 571 // SU->TopReadyCycle was set to CurrCycle when it was scheduled. However,
572 // CurrCycle may have advanced since then.
610 // SU->BotReadyCycle was set to CurrCycle when it was scheduled. However,
611 // CurrCycle may have advanced since then.
733 // This sets the scheduled node's ReadyCycle to CurrCycle. When updateQueues
    [all...]
  /external/swiftshader/third_party/llvm-7.0/llvm/lib/CodeGen/
MachineScheduler.cpp 641 // SU->TopReadyCycle was set to CurrCycle when it was scheduled. However,
642 // CurrCycle may have advanced since then.
678 // SU->BotReadyCycle was set to CurrCycle when it was scheduled. However,
679 // CurrCycle may have advanced since then.
811 // This sets the scheduled node's ReadyCycle to CurrCycle. When updateQueues
    [all...]

Completed in 290 milliseconds